Gail McCarthy, real estate investor and industry coach explains the best time to visit a property, why you should try to see a property before a purchase and sale agreement, running the numbers in this multifamily apartment business, why you can't afford to fly for every LOI you receive, action steps to take prior to purchase and sale, how to manage your assets once your money is in "cash flow" on a group of properties, and how to judge building materials for B and C property classes.

Gail McCarthy is a RE Mentor Business Accelerator and Mentor. She has been a key principal and asset manager for 13 years, acquiring approximately 300 multifamily and storage units in Alabama and New Hampshire. Her experience includes market research, financial analysis, due diligence, acquisitions, and asset management. Her role is typically to take the lead with lenders, attorneys and accountants. Gail also has experience in hard money lending and single family fix/flips. She owns an independent real estate brokerage in New Hampshire. Her specialty is mentoring real estate investors across the US and Canada.
